Modern equipment help improve medical examination and treatment service quality at Hospital A in Thai Nguyen province (Photo: VNA) Hanoi (VNA) – Legislators at the 15th National Assembly (NA) discussed in groups the draft Law on Medical Examination and Treatment (revised) on May 26 during their ongoing third session. Many deputies pointed out that after 10 years of implementation, the law has created an important legal framework for the caring and protection of people’s health through the management of medical activities, ensuring rights of patients. However, it has exposed a number of shortcomings and limitation, making it no longer suitable to the reality. According to Bac Ninh province’s representative Nguyen Thi Ha, the bill should specify policies to encourage the research and application of science and technologies in medical examination and treatment through support in land use, tax and finance, thus drawing more investment and knowledge from other countries. Participants discuss about victim-centered methods in the prosecution of violent cases in the criminal justice system (Photo: https://toquoc.vn/) Thanh Hoa (VNA) – An intensive training course on experience in handling and prosecuting gender-based violence and abuse against women and children wrapped up in Hoang Hoa district of the north-central province of Thanh Hoa on May 26. The three-day course, jointly organised by the United Nations (UN) Entity for Gender Equality and the Empowerment of Women (UN Women) in Asia-Pacific, UN Women in Vietnam and the Vietnam Women's Union (VWU), aims to meet the urgent need for access to justice for women and children experiencing violence. It is part of the activities in the framework of the programme “Ending violence against women to strengthen the provision of essential services to women experiencing violence" implemented by UN Women .
